WebOct 31, 2024 · The notation used for the relational patterns is equivalent to the comparison operators. > for greater than >= for greater or equal than < for less than <= for less or equal than; Relational patterns are introduced in C# 9.0. Starting in C# 9, you can use use the relational operator >, >=, <, <= to match the result of the expression with constants in the switch statement.
